[quote name='Billy Apple' timestamp='1442342585' post='2866263'] The first Orange heads were built by Matt Mathias at Matamp and badged Orange. Orange was just a music store in London at the time selling mainly second hand gear. Matt was a purist and perfectionist who was not at all keen on hi-gain. It was one of the reasons Matt and Cliff Cooper fell out, as Cliff was pushing for more dirt. So vintage Orange will be cleaner. Plus all the older Orange stuff is 100% hand-wired and very reliable, unlike the new Chinese built printed circuit board stuff. I don't think you could even compare them, two totally different things. [/quote] Late seventies/early eighties I had a Marshall Superbass 100w valve head with two 412 cabs. Boy it could fill a room but I wanted a clean sound back then, but it was unachievable with the Marshall. Knowing what I know now tho it would probably be tone nirvana for me these days! I remember Matt at Matamp giving me a factory tour and demo of his 100w Matamp. He took great delight in showing how loud it could go, but it was no more than a distorted mush. Had an Orange valve head back then too. It used to cutout midsong every gig, same song everytime. -
